Presumption of Innocence /prɪˈzʌmpʃən əv ˈɪnəsəns/
Presumption of innocence ensures the accused is treated as innocent until proven guilty.
Punitive Damages /ˈpjuː.nə.t̬ɪv ˈdæm·ɪ·dʒɪz/
Punitive damages punish wrongful and egregious behavior.
Probation /proʊˈbeɪ ʃən/
Probation allows offenders to remain in the community under supervision instead of serving jail time.
